Moving pages in a PDF Viewer refers to the ability to change the order of pages within a document to better organize content, improve readability, or tailor the structure for specific purposes. This feature is especially useful when compiling reports, combining multiple documents, or correcting the sequence of scanned pages. By simply dragging and dropping pages into the desired order, users can streamline workflows without the need for re-creating or re-exporting files. Benefits include enhanced document clarity, improved presentation flow, and increased efficiency in content management. For example, a marketing team can reorder proposal sections for greater impact, or a legal department can organize case files by relevance.

Logging in communication and messaging components is essential for monitoring, diagnosing, and auditing data exchange processes across applications. Whether handling email, file transfers, or secure messaging, robust logging capabilities help developers track the flow of information, capture errors, and ensure compliance with operational and security standards. By recording detailed transaction histories, logs also provide valuable insights for performance optimization and issue resolution.

The Syncfusion Essential Studio WPF 2025 Volume 2 update introduces AES GCM encryption support for PDF documents, giving developers a reliable and efficient way to implement modern, standards-based security in their applications. This enhancement allows for both encryption and decryption of PDFs using a cryptographic method that ensures data confidentiality and integrity, making it easier to comply with industry regulations and safeguard sensitive content. By integrating AES GCM, developers can build secure document workflows with performance-optimized encryption that is widely supported across current platforms and environments.

Spreadsheet security features are essential tools designed to protect sensitive data, ensure data integrity, and control user access within spreadsheet applications. These capabilities typically include such measures as password protection or cell locking, and are used to prevent the unauthorized viewing or modification of content in the spreadsheet. Implementing security measures in their spreadsheets allows organizations to maintain compliance with data security standards or data governance policies, and avoid accidental or malicious data loss or alteration. This level of control is particularly important in environments where multiple users collaborate on financial models, project plans, or other critical datasets.
